通过与 Jira 对比,让您更全面了解 PingCode

  • 首页
  • 需求与产品管理
  • 项目管理
  • 测试与缺陷管理
  • 知识管理
  • 效能度量
        • 更多产品

          客户为中心的产品管理工具

          专业的软件研发项目管理工具

          简单易用的团队知识库管理

          可量化的研发效能度量工具

          测试用例维护与计划执行

          以团队为中心的协作沟通

          研发工作流自动化工具

          账号认证与安全管理工具

          Why PingCode
          为什么选择 PingCode ?

          6000+企业信赖之选,为研发团队降本增效

        • 行业解决方案
          先进制造(即将上线)
        • 解决方案1
        • 解决方案2
  • Jira替代方案

25人以下免费

目录

渗透测试中的身份和访问管理评估

渗透测试中的身份和访问管理评估

身份和访问管理(IAM)是信息安全的核心组成部分,而渗透测试是评估IAM有效性的主要方式。通过这种测试,可以评估IAM的策略执行、用户身份验证、权限分配和监控等关键方面,以确保只有合法用户能够获取适当的资源和数据。 渗透测试方法通常涉及攻击者可能采用的技术,比如社交工程、密码猜测、会话劫持和利用系统配置错误。

渗透测试专家着重模拟攻击者的行为,以发现潜在的IAM弱点,并推荐相应的改进措施。他们通过执行一系列攻击场景测试系统中的策略是否有效,并且能否有效抵御恶意攻击,进而保护组织的信息安全。评估的深入性是此类测试成功的关键,因为它能揭示系统中可能被忽视的风险点。

一、IAM的重要性

身份和访问管理对于维护信息系统的安全至关重要。它确保只有授权用户才能访问敏感资源,并且他们只能访问对其工作至关重要的信息。有效的IAM策略可减少数据泄漏的风险、提高生产力、并遵守法规要求。

用户身份验证通常是通过用户名和密码、两因素认证或生物识别等手段完成。然而,糟糕的管理实践,例如重复使用弱密码、权限滥用或未及时撤销前员工的访问权限,都会导致安全漏洞。因此,评估IAM的实施情况是确保企业安全的关键步骤

二、渗透测试的方法与实施

渗透测试通过模拟黑客的行为来揭露IAM中的漏洞。从外部和内部两个维度对系统进行测试是至关重要的,因为这两个方面都可能存在安全威胁。通过一系列定制的攻击场景,测试人员能够评估IAM系统的韧性。

测试过程包括但不限于:社会工程学、弱点扫描、密码破解、访问控制绕过、权限升级和审计日志分析。渗透测试必须由专业人员使用授权的方式进行,以避免对正常业务造成中断。

三、社交工程和密码攻击

社交工程技术中,测试者尝试通过欺骗员工获取敏感信息。他们可能会冒充合法用户请求密码重置,或是通过钓鱼邮件诱导员工透露登录凭证。

密码攻击包括使用各种方法猜测或破解密码,如暴力破解攻击、字典攻击和雨滴攻击(寻找系统中使用多个服务的相同密码)。这些攻击的成功强调了定期更换强密码和使用多重认证的重要性。

四、会话劫持和权限漏洞

会话劫持中,攻击者试图拦截用户的会话以获取对受保护资源的未授权访问。利用不安全的通信协议和未加密的数据传输是常见的攻击手段。

权限漏洞则涉及滥用或错误配置的权限设置,导致用户获得了本不该具备的访问权。渗透测试员会尝试使用这些漏洞提升自己的权限,以检测系统的权限分配和管理策略。

五、技术和工具的应用

渗透测试使用多种工具和技术来测试IAM系统。这些工具可自动发现系统中的弱点、模拟攻击行为、劫持通信和测试网络安全配置。所有这些工具都必须在合法和受控的环境中使用,通过模拟恶意行为来检验防御机制是否稳固。

六、测试后的报告和改进建议

渗透测试结束后,测试团队会提供一份详尽的报告。这份报告总结了测试发现的问题,并提供了具体的改进建议。这些建议包括技术改进、政策调整和员工培训,以增强IAM系统的整体安全性。

七、持续的IAM评估和改进

IAM的评估和改善是一个持续的过程,不是一次性的任务。随着新的威胁不断出现,必须定期重新评估和更新IAM策略。这要求企业建立定期审查的流程,并对新兴的安全威胁保持警觉

通过定期的渗透测试和IAM评估,企业能够持续改善其安全性,确保只有合法用户能够访问敏感资源和数据。这不仅帮助保护企业免遭数据泄露,还有助于建立信任和遵守监管要求。

相关问答FAQs:

什么是渗透测试中的身份和访问管理评估? 渗透测试中的身份和访问管理评估是指对一个系统或网络的身份验证和授权机制进行评估,以确定是否存在安全漏洞或弱点。这种评估能够揭示系统中可能存在的身份和访问管理薄弱环节,为企业提供相关修复建议和改进方案。

为什么身份和访问管理评估在渗透测试中很重要? 身份和访问管理是网络安全的关键组成部分,可以决定着系统和网络的安全性。一个强大而有效的身份和访问管理系统可以确保只有经过授权的用户才能访问敏感信息,从而防止未经授权的人员入侵和数据泄露。因此,在渗透测试中对身份和访问管理进行评估可以帮助发现和修复潜在的安全漏洞,提高系统的安全性和保护用户的隐私。

身份和访问管理评估的常见方法有哪些? 身份和访问管理评估的方法有很多,常见的包括:对系统的身份验证过程进行测试,如密码强度测试、多因素身份验证测试等;对系统的授权机制进行评估,如角色和权限管理、访问控制策略等;对系统的会话管理进行测试,如强制用户登出、会话注销等。综合运用这些方法可以全面评估身份和访问管理的安全性,并提供相关的改进建议。

相关文章